Frequently Asked Questions
What should a Harris County business clarify before a website redesign?
Start with the service mix, real service area, ideal buyer, proof available for publication, and the one action a visitor should be able to take without friction.
Why can a Harris County location hub need more than a city name in the title?
Because a useful page should explain the local market context, the company’s operating area, and the relevant service and industry paths instead of repeating a generic claim about online presence.
Which Harris County pages should be published first?
Begin with the city hub, the primary service pages, the industries that match documented experience, and nearby-market pages only where the business has a real reason to serve them.
How should Harris County companies describe a wider service area?
Use accurate city, county, and regional references; explain practical coverage and avoid creating duplicate pages that add no unique customer information.
What makes a Harris County service page credible?
Specific scope, evidence-backed trust information, clear pricing or consultation expectations where approved, and an accessible route to contact.
Can AI-search readiness replace technical SEO for Harris County businesses?
No. Clear information, crawlable HTML, accurate schema, internal links, and documented trust signals should support the same user experience rather than replace foundational SEO work.
